How to renovate your bathroom on a budget

Creating an amazing bathroom renovation can be difficult when you’re on a budget, but a few tips and tricks could save you some serious cash and allow you to have the bathroom of your dreams without the huge price tag.

Here are some tips for renovating your bathroom without spending top dollar.

Shop at bathroom outlets

If you’re in the market for a new bathroom consider taking a look at outlet stores for your tiles, vanity, tapware or shower screen, you’ll be surprised how much you can save by checking out discontinued accessories and materials that are limited in supply.

Just be sure to know the correct amounts that you need, as often once items are sold at outlets it’s difficult to find extras – especially if you are tiling your bathroom and need an extra few metres of tiles!

Create a unique bathroom design

Rather than the traditional base with two or three walls of glass, an open shower could save you a packet on your reno budget.

Using only one pane of glass, tiling the floor and creating a larger, lighter more usable shower space – could save you money and provide a modern and contemporary space that is stylish to boot.

Use less tiles

We all love the look of wall to ceiling tiles, but it’s super expensive and requires a whole stack of tiles.

If you’re looking to save some money, why not look at tiling to the top of the glass shower screen and then adding skirting around the rest of the bathroom – depending on your tile and size of the bathroom it could save you hundreds if not thousands of dollars on your bathroom reno.

Custom vs out of a box?

There is a vast range of ‘out of the box’ solutions for just about anything these days – bathrooms are no different. Your vanity units are a perfect example of this – why have it custom built when you can buy one in that is pre-made and cheaper? As long as it fits your space as you want it…you will save a packet.

Any renovations are taxing, however, if you spend a little time, shopping around, buying ahead of your build if you can store the materials in a clean/dry place ahead of time you will save.

If you’re looking to renovate your bathroom on a budget consider shopping around, putting a spin on the traditional bathroom and buying ready made to save big bucks on your renovation budget.
